Experience Maine’s Marine Economy Program

Our Experience Maine’s Marine Economy Program is a field-based and experiential excursion program that took students to some of the most innovative marine-based industry and research facilities in the midcoast region of Maine.

Aquatots Kicks Off With a Splash!

Aquatots , our new summer preschool program, used pitchers and funnels to pour water into graduated cylinders. They chose their favorite number and either poured out water or added more to try to get an exact measurement. They even explored why an equal amount of water looks like different amounts in large and small containers.
